Georgia Beatrice Robertson Bishop was born in 1928 in Austin, Travis, Texas, USA, the child of Keath Preston Burke And Frances Lorane Lovelady Robertson. In 1935, Georgia Beatrice Robertson Bishop resided in Houston, Harris, Texas. In 1940, Georgia Beatrice Robertson Bishop resided in Justice Precinct #2, Houston, Harris, Texas, USA. Georgia Beatrice Robertson Bishop married Baylor Owen Bishop, and had children including Cynthia Ann Bishop. Georgia Beatrice Robertson Bishop passed away in 2020 in Houston, Harris County, Texas, United States of America.
